isPermaLink="false">http://www.5dollardinners.com/?p=1717#comment-15499</guid> <description>I freeze pesto as well.  I primarily freeze in small amounts to add to soup, pizza, etc. later in the year.  For that I use a muffin tin.  Put muffin liners in the tin and a couple of spoons of pesto.  After it&#039;s frozen take the pesto and paper liners out and freeze in a freezer bag or container.  Take out as many (or few) as you need later.
